Designed for deployment in public transport, emergency response, logistics, and fleet management, our in-vehicle Embedded Box PCs offer shock and vibration resistance, wide voltage input, and ignition sensing capabilities for reliable mobile performance.
These compact, fanless systems are often E-Mark certified and feature built-in GPS, CANbus, and wireless connectivity options, making them ideal for live video recording, telematics, and vehicle diagnostics.

GPU computer custom built for autonomous vehicle control system
WMG, University of Warwick’s Intelligent Vehicles research group works with a variety of industrial partners to address challenges presented by the concept of autonomous vehicles. Operating within this department is a multi-million pound funded project ‘Cloud assisted real time methods for autonomy’ (CARMA), working in collaboration with Jaguar Land Rover and EPSRC (Engineering and Physical Sciences Research Council).
